引言:
当前企业规模越来越大,业务量不断增加,对ERP系统的并发量提出了更高的要求。然而,当ERP系统的并发量超过当前设置的最大并发数时,就会出现性能下降、系统崩溃等问题,影响到企业正常的运营。本文将介绍当ERP系统超过当前最大并发数时应该如何处理。
提高系统性能:
1. 优化数据库:
通过对数据库进行索引优化、表结构调整等操作,可以提高数据库的读写效率,从而提升系统的并发处理能力。
2. 增加服务器硬件:
增加服务器的内存、CPU等硬件配置,可以提升系统的并发处理能力,确保系统能够承受更多的用户访问。
3. 使用缓存技术:
利用缓存技术将部分数据缓存在内存中,可以减轻数据库的压力,提升系统的并发处理能力。
优化系统架构:
1. 分布式架构:
***用分布式架构可以将系统的负载分散到不同的服务器上,提高系统的并发处理能力,避免单点故障。
2. 引入负载均衡:
通过负载均衡技术,可以将用户的访问均衡分配到不同的服务器上,避免单台服务器承担过大的压力。
3. 异步处理:
将一些耗时的操作改为异步处理,可以提高系统的并发处理能力,减少用户等待时间,提升用户体验。
监控和调优:
1. 实时监控系统性能:
通过实时监控系统的性能指标,可以及时发现系统的瓶颈,***取相应的优化措施。
2. 定期优化系统:
定期对系统进行优化,及时清理无用数据、垃圾文件等,保持系统的高效运行状态。
3. 做好灾备预案:
制定灾备预案,一旦系统发生问题,能够快速恢复到正常运行状态,避免对企业造成严重影响。
结论:
当ERP系统的并发量超过当前最大并发数时,企业需要及时***取措施优化系统性能、优化系统架构、监控和调优系统,确保系统能够稳定运行,满足企业的业务需求。
ERP系统的重要性和普遍应用
企业******(ERP)系统是一种集成管理企业各项业务流程的软件系统,涵盖了财务、人力***、供应链管理等各个方面,对企业的管理和运营起着至关重要的作用。
ERP系统的普遍应用
目前,几乎所有规模较大的企业都在使用ERP系统,它帮助企业高效地管理***、提高生产效率、优化成本控制,并且提供全面的数据分析与决策支持。
ERP系统的并发数限制
ERP系统的并发数是指系统同时处理的用户请求数量,一旦超过了系统当前的最大并发数,就会导致系统性能下降甚至崩溃。
超过当前最大并发数时的处理方法
当ERP系统的并发数超过了当前的最大限制时,可以通过以下方法进行处理:
优化系统配置
可以通过提升服务器性能、优化数据库配置等方式,提高系统的并发处理能力。
升级系统版本
升级到更高版本的ERP系统,通常新版本会对并发数进行优化,提高系统的承载能力。
使用分布式架构
将ERP系统改造为分布式架构,可以通过横向扩展来提高系统的并发处理能力。
限制用户访问
在系统超过最大并发数时,临时限制部分用户的访问权限,以降低系统的压力。
定期监控和调整
对ERP系统的并发数进行定期监控,根据实际情况随时调整系统配置和优化方案,以保证系统的稳定运行。
总之,对于ERP系统超过当前最大并发数的情况,企业应该制定相应的处理策略,保证系统能够稳定高效地运行。
最大并发数的概念和重要性
最大并发数是指在一定时间内系统可以处理的最大并发请求数量,对于ERP系统来说,最大并发数的大小决定了系统能够同时处理的用户数量,直接影响到系统的性能和稳定性。如果ERP系统超过了当前的最大并发数,就会出现系统响应缓慢甚至崩溃的情况,严重影响业务流程和用户体验。
超过当前最大并发数的影响
1. 系统性能下降:超过最大并发数会导致系统响应时间变长,影响用户的正常使用。
2. 系统崩溃:严重超过最大并发数可能导致系统崩溃,无***常运行。
3. 数据丢失:在并发数超载的情况下,系统可能无***常保存数据,导致数据丢失的风险加大。
4. 安全风险:并发数超载可能会引发安全漏洞,导致系统遭受攻击。
应对超过最大并发数的方法
1. 系统优化
对系统进行优化,提高系统的吞吐量和并发处理能力,包括对系统架构、数据库、缓存、网络等方面进行调整和优化。
2. 增加硬件设备
通过增加服务器数量、升级硬件配置等方式来提升系统的并发处理能力。
3. 负载均衡
***用负载均衡技术,将并发请求均匀分发到多台服务器上处理,从而提高系统的并发处理能力。
4. 引入缓存机制
通过引入缓存机制,减少对数据库等系统***的访问,提高系统的并发处理能力。
5. 定期压力测试
定期进行系统压力测试,了解系统的并发处理能力,并根据测试结果进行相应的调整和优化。
结论
最大并发数是ERP系统性能和稳定性的重要指标,超过当前最大并发数会给系统带来严重影响。因此,需要***取相应的措施来提升系统的并发处理能力,保障系统的稳定运行。
在使用ERP系统的过程中,如果系统的并发数超过当前系统最大并发数,会导致系统性能下降甚至系统崩溃。因此,需要对ERP系统并发数超负荷的原因进行分析,以便解决这一问题。
错误配置
首先,ERP系统并发数超负荷的原因之一可能是系统的错误配置。这包括数据库连接池、线程数、内存分配等参数的配置错误。因此,需要对系统的配置进行详细的审查与调整,以确保系统能够承载更大的并发数。
系统***不足
其次,ERP系统并发数超负荷的原因还可能是系统***不足。这包括服务器的CPU、内存、硬盘等硬件***以及网络带宽等。因此,需要对系统的***进行评估和扩展,以满足更大的并发需求。
程序设计不合理
最后,ERP系统并发数超负荷的原因还可能是程序设计不合理。这包括数据库查询优化、业务逻辑设计等。因此,需要进行系统代码的审查与优化,以提高系统的并发处理能力。
综上所述,对于ERP系统并发数超负荷的原因分析,需要从错误配置、系统***不足和程序设计不合理等方面进行全面的检查与调整,以确保系统能够稳定地承载更大的并发数。
检测和监控超负荷情况
超过当前最大并发数是ERP系统面临的一个常见问题,为了及时发现并解决这种情况,需要进行检测和监控超负荷情况。
设置监控预警机制
首先,可以设置监控预警机制,即通过监控软件实时监测系统的负荷情况,一旦超过当前最大并发数,系统就会自动发送预警通知给相关人员,以便他们及时***取措施。
使用性能测试工具进行检测
其次,可以使用性能测试工具进行检测,这些工具可以模拟大量用户同时访问系统,从而检测系统的性能是否能够承受当前的并发数。在使用性能测试工具时,需要确保测试的正确性和可行性,以便准确评估系统的性能状况。
当ERP系统的并发数超过当前最大负荷时,以下是一些缓解方法:
系统优化
对ERP系统进行优化可以提高系统的吞吐量和响应速度,从而减少并发压力。
数据库优化
通过索引优化、查询优化和表结构优化等手段,可以提升数据库的查询性能,降低数据库负载。
代码优化
对ERP系统的代码进行优化,消除性能瓶颈和多余的计算,提高系统的并发处理能力。
***扩展
增加服务器硬件***和使用负载均衡技术可以有效地增加系统对并发请求的处理能力。
增加服务器硬件***
通过增加CPU、内存、存储等硬件***,可以提升系统的承载能力,降低系统的响应时间。
使用负载均衡技术
通过负载均衡技术将用户请求均衡地分发到多台服务器上进行处理,从而提高系统的并发处理能力。
引入缓存机制
利用缓存机制可以有效地减轻数据库的压力,提高系统的并发处理能力。
确保缓存的正确性和可行性
在引入缓存机制时,需要确保缓存数据的正确性和实时性,避免缓存数据和数据库数据的不一致。
***用适当的缓存策略
根据实际情况***取合适的缓存策略,如页面缓存、数据缓存和查询结果缓存等,优化系统性能。
***取以上措施可以有效地缓解ERP系统并发数超负荷的问题,提高系统的稳定性和性能。
针对ERP系统超过当前最大并发数的情况,需要制定应对超负荷情况的预案,包括制定应急响应***和实施故障转移和恢复策略。
应急响应***
制定应急响应***是为了在系统超负荷情况下能够快速、有效地应对问题,保障系统稳定运行。预案内容包括:
紧急通知机制
建立紧急通知渠道,确保信息及时传达给相关人员。
任务分工
明确各个责任人员的任务分工,确保能够迅速***取行动。
系统监控与分析
加强对系统的实时监控,及时分析系统负荷情况,做出相应决策。
故障转移和恢复策略
故障转移和恢复策略的实施,是为了在系统发生超负荷情况时,能够迅速将负载转移到备用系统上,保障系统可用性。策略包括:
备用系统准备
确保备用系统的正常运行,随时待命。
负载均衡机制
利用负载均衡技术,将超负荷的请求分摊到多台服务器上,提高系统整体承载能力。
数据恢复方案
建立完善的数据恢复方案,确保系统恢复后数据完整性和一致性。
在实施故障转移和恢复策略时,需要确保策略的正确性和可行性,以及及时跟进监控系统的运行状态,做出相应的调整和优化。
ERP系统超过当前最大并发数的问题及解决方法
1. 问题分析
当前最大并发数的设定是为了保证系统的稳定性和性能,一旦超过最大并发数,系统可能出现性能下降、响应延迟甚至崩溃的情况。
1.1 原因分析
超过最大并发数通常是由于系统设计不合理、硬件***不足、网络带宽不足、业务量突然增加等因素导致的。
1.2 影响分析
超过最大并发数会导致系统性能下降,影响用户体验,严重时甚至引发数据丢失和业务中断的风险。
2. 解决方法
2.1 扩展硬件***
通过增加服务器的内存、CPU等硬件***,扩大系统的承载能力。
2.2 优化系统设计
对系统架构进行优化,使用分布式架构、缓存技术等手段提高系统的并发处理能力。
2.3 备份和容灾方案
建立完备的数据备份和容灾方案,一旦系统超载导致崩溃,能够快速恢复并保证业务连续性。
2.4 加强监控和预警
实时监控系统的并发数及***利用情况,设置预警机制,及时发现并解决潜在的并发问题。
3. 持续优化
超过当前最大并发数的问题不是一次性的,而是需要持续关注和优化的过程。定期评估系统的承载能力和业务需求,针对性地进行调整和优化。
通过扩展硬件***、优化系统设计、建立备份和容灾方案以及加强监控预警,可以有效解决ERP系统超过当前最大并发数的问题,保障系统稳定运行。